JOB TITLE: Career Success Senior Program Manager

REPORTS TO: Director, College and Career Success

FLSA STATUS: Full-Time, Exempt

Hybrid Schedule (THIS ROLE REQUIRES 2 IN-OFFICE DAYS AT OUR NEW YORK OFFICE)

Our Mission: To build and support mentoring relationships to ignite the biggest possible futures for youth.

Our Vision: All youth achieve their full potential

Our Values: Put Youth First; Engage with Empathy; Advance Diversity, Equity & Inclusion; Operate with Integrity; Invest in Learning & Innovation

As the nation's first and NYC's largest youth mentoring organization, Big Brothers Big Sisters of New York City (BBBS of NYC) connects generations of New Yorkers by matching a caring adult mentor, a Big, with a New York City youth, a Little. Through evidence-based, goal-centered, professional supporting programming, BBBS of NYC provides consistent support and guidance to matches that result in longer, stronger match relationships that advance the social-emotional development and academic progress of young people across the five boroughs.

JOB SUMMARY

As an integral member of the College & Career Success (CCS) team, the Career Success Senior Program Manager (SPM) will oversee all aspects of the Career Pathways program, a 10-session virtual career mentoring program for our junior and senior college Scholars. This SPM will work with CCS Program Managers to recruit scholars for each program, work alongside a Corporate Coordinator per corporation to populate program days and help recruit volunteers, match students with volunteers, and facilitate programs (following curriculum). Along with this, the SPM will serve as the case manager for all fifth-year scholars (and their CCS mentors) and provide alumni engagement support for recent graduates of the program. They will also play the lead role in the development and implementation of all career access curriculum. The ideal candidate will have a firm belief in the power of mentoring, demonstrated experience working with upperclassmen college students, a clear understanding of the barriers facing first-generation college students, and experience with developing and facilitating relevant workshops to young adults related to career exploration and success. Additionally, the College & Career Success Program is an innovative and developing service delivery model at BBBS of NYC. The SPM will also strongly contribute to overall program design, implementation, management, and evaluation.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ES:

Career Pathways Program Management:
  • Facilitate 5-6 Career Pathways programs per year to support career success. Work with corporations to recruit volunteers, hold information sessions, and populate speakers for guest panels.
  • Collaborate cross-departmentally to ensure a smooth volunteer onboarding process for prospective mentors.
  • Work alongside CCS Program Managers to recruit scholars, hold info sessions, select scholar cohorts, and support Career Pathways matches as needed.
  • Contribute to the development of funding proposals and reports.
  • Attend external meetings for professional associations and partnerships as needed.
Program Development:
  • Utilize data tracking and program evaluation methods to analyze program impact and participant needs, and adjust curriculum as needed.
  • Serve as one of the departmental leaders in developing new tracking and data collection systems in partnership with the Quality Assurance Department.
  • Act as the primary expert on all career success-related training and workshops internally and externally.
  • Create & implement one-off career-focused workshops as needed.
  • Other responsibilities as needed.
Year 5 Case Management:
  • Provide tailored, individualized coaching and guidance and deliver workshops and resources to fifth-year CCS scholars and their mentors, with a focus on college completion and career access.
  • Maintain regular contact with matches to assess the strength of mentoring relationships; proactively address barriers and leverage both internal and external resources for college completion and career exploration and success.
  • Update records on a routine basis; assist with statistical reports, demographic, and outcome tracking. Input all survey data into our database. Create and maintain department forms and documents.
  • Manage and/or contribute to CCS newsletter to promote resource access and program engagement.
Alumni Engagement & Support
  • Build structure to CCS alumni engagement strategy including but not limited to maintaining regular communication with graduated scholars, updating contact info, collecting survey data, and organizing alumni events.
  • Collaborate cross-departmentally to engage alumni in mentor recruitment, marketing opportunities, speaking engagements, and fundraising.
Requirements

JOB REQUIREMENTS:
  • Passion for and alignment with the mission and values of BBBS of NYC.
  • 5+ years' experience working with upperclassmen college students in a formal career success program or in a career advising setting.
  • Track record of successfully supporting upperclassmen college students in navigating job, internship, and/or graduate school applications.
  • Project management experience is highly preferred.
  • Experience engaging and managing adult volunteers; comfort building relationships with a variety of stakeholders.
  • Skilled, expert facilitator comfortable delivering programming and curriculum to a diverse set of stakeholders both in-person and virtually via Zoom and Microsoft Teams.
  • Commitment to diversity, equity, and inclusion; understanding of the institutional and systemic barriers to success faced by first-generation college students.
